Senior Compliance Manager (General Compliance), Retail Banking
A leading retail banking institution seeks a Senior Compliance Manager in Hong Kong to strengthen regulatory governance, shape enterprise-wide compliance strategy, and drive regulatory excellence across the organisation.
Key responsibilities:
- Lead compliance risk assessments and investigations to strengthen regulatory governance
- Manage regulatory inspections and reporting with HKMA, SFC, and other authorities
- Monitor regulatory changes and implement compliance requirements across the business
- Enhance compliance policies and documentation to align with evolving regulations
- Deliver regulatory reports and assessments to support effective risk management
Candidate profile:
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Law, or a related discipline with 8–10 years’ banking compliance experience
- Strong knowledge of HKMA, SFC, and Hong Kong banking regulations and compliance frameworks
- Proven experience liaising with regulators and managing regulatory inspections within the banking industry
- Excellent prioritisation, organisation, and stakeholder management skills in a regulated financial services environment
- Strong written and spoken English, Cantonese, and Mandarin communication skills
